Common Household Cleaners and Their Chemical Composition

Bleach is a common disinfectant that contains sodium hypochlorite. It kills germs but can be dangerous if not used carefully. It can also release harmful fumes when mixed with other cleaners.

Detergents use surfactants to clean dirt and stains. These surfactants come in different types, each with its own cleaning power.

Solvents in cleaners like window cleaners dissolve tough dirt. But they can be harsh on skin and need good air flow. Furniture polishes protect wood with silicones or waxes, keeping it shiny and dust-free.

Knowing what’s in our cleaners helps us use them right. Handling and disposing of them properly keeps us and the environment safe.

Carbon Capture and Utilization in Power Plants

Challenges and Opportunities in Carbon Capture Technology

The world is facing a big challenge with climate change. Carbon capture and utilization technology is seen as a key solution. Carbon capture removes carbon dioxide from power plant exhaust. This prevents it from entering the atmosphere.

But, this technology has its own hurdles. It needs a lot of energy and isn’t very profitable. Yet, new ideas could make it more viable and widely used.

  • The cost of carbon capture can change with market prices, affecting profits.
  • Running carbon capture on coal-fired plants is hard because of efficiency losses. New control systems are needed.
  • The energy needed for carbon capture is a big problem. Improving how it works is key.

Despite the challenges, the benefits of carbon capture and utilization in power plants are huge. Scientists are working hard to make it better and cheaper. They aim to help reduce greenhouse gas emissions from power plants.

Enzymatic Production of Valuable Chemicals

The production of solketal esters through enzymes is becoming more popular. It’s seen as a green way to make chemicals compared to old methods. Solketal esters are useful in many ways, like as food additives, germ fighters, fuel boosters, and plastic softeners.

Using enzymes, like lipases, helps make these chemicals better and cleaner. This method is gentler, more precise, and creates less waste than traditional methods.

Solketal Esters and Their Applications

Looking into how to make solketal esters with enzymes could make industry greener and cheaper. A study showed that 83% of acid was turned into a solketal ester in 150 minutes. This was done in heptane using an enzyme called Eversa® Transform 2.0 (ET2.0).

The study also found that the best match between ET2.0 and its support was at pH 5.0. The enzyme’s best working point is around pH 4.4.

Solketal esters have many uses, showing their value. They can be food enhancers, germ fighters, fuel boosters, and plastic softeners. Finding ways to make them with enzymes could make industry more sustainable and affordable.

Safety Considerations in Everyday Chemistry

Chemistry is all around us, in our homes and communities. It’s key to know how to handle chemicals safely. This includes how to store and throw away household chemicals properly. Knowing about the risks helps keep us safe and healthy.

Storing and handling chemicals right is a big deal. Products like cleaners, paints, and pesticides can be dangerous if not used correctly. Always follow the instructions, keep them in their original containers, and out of kids’ and pets’ reach.

Getting rid of chemicals the right way is also vital. This stops pollution and keeps us healthy. Check with your local government for how to dispose of hazardous waste like electronics and certain cleaners. Wrong disposal can harm our air, water, and soil, and us.

It’s also important to know about health risks from chemicals. Some products can irritate, cause allergies, or even cancer. Always read labels, understand the risks, and use protective gear. Make sure the area is well-ventilated and follow the instructions.

By being aware of safety considerations in everyday chemistry, we can all help make our world safer and healthier. This benefits us, our families, and our communities.
